It is located in the Haut-Languedoc Regional Natural Park. The village is classified among the most beautiful villages in France.
Your stopover is close to the heart of the village, shops and services are within walking distance.
Not far away, the "voie verte" is built on the old Mazamet/Bédarieux railway line. For about 75 kilometres, it offers a protected area for cycling, jogging and walking.
Olargues is a perched village in the upper Languedoc with the Caroux river in the background. It hangs on a rocky hillock with, at the top, the old keep of the medieval castle transformed into a bell tower. The Devil's Bridge, below, was built in the 12th century. The perfect architecture of the site and its typically medieval appearance have earned Olargues a place on the National Inventory of Sites.
